Recognised as one of the world's leading television festivals, the Monte-Carlo Television Festival has, for 65 years, brought together acclaimed actors, producers, broadcasters, creators, and industry leaders in the Principality of Monaco. Major studios, networks, digital platforms and internationally renowned talent gather to compete for the prestigious Golden Nymph Awards.

About Pogossian Luxury Brand House
Since 1992, the Pogossian family has been creating exceptional luxury products. Present in more than 50 countries, the House embodies a vision rooted in craftsmanship, creativity and excellence, offering a discerning international clientele sophisticated and timeless experiences.
Among its flagship brands owned by Armen Pogossian is Jardins d'Armenie – Royal Brandy. Produced in Armenia from Voskehat grapes and aged for 35 years through a distinctive multi-stage maturation process, the brand embodies a vision where cultural heritage and contemporary luxury meet. Combining traditional craftsmanship with contemporary presentation, Jardins d'Armenie offers a refined expression of Armenia's cultural and winemaking heritage.
